Streetwear

Streetwear is a style of clothing that emerged from skate, hip-hop, and graffiti culture in the 1980s. It is characterized by its casual, comfortable, and utilitarian nature that appeals to the younger generation. The streetwear style features oversized silhouettes, hoodies, T-shirts, sneakers, and graphic prints. Some of the popular streetwear brands include Supreme, BAPE, Off-White, and Palace.

High Fashion

High fashion is a style of clothing that is typically associated with luxury and high-end designers. It is characterized by its bespoke tailoring, intricate details, and unique designs. High fashion garments are often made from premium fabrics and designed to fit perfectly. Some examples of high fashion brands include Chanel, Dior, Prada, Gucci, and Louis Vuitton.

Differences between Streetwear and High Fashion

Aesthetics

The most prominent difference between streetwear and high fashion is their aesthetics. While streetwear often features bold graphics and simple designs, high fashion is characterized by its intricate detailing and bespoke tailoring. Streetwear is more casual and relaxed, while high fashion is often associated with glamour and luxury.

Price

Another significant difference between streetwear and high fashion is their price point. Streetwear is typically less expensive and more accessible than high fashion. It’s not unusual to find a popular streetwear T-shirt or hoodie for less than $50, while high fashion garments can run into the thousands of dollars.

Target Audience

Streetwear is often associated with younger generations, especially millennials and Gen Z, who value comfort and casual style. On the other hand, high fashion is typically associated with an older, more sophisticated clientele who value luxury and exclusivity.

Similarities between Streetwear and High Fashion

Influence

Despite their differences, streetwear and high fashion have a lot in common when it comes to their influence. Both styles have had a significant impact on the fashion industry and have inspired each other in various ways. For example, luxury fashion brands have been incorporating streetwear elements into their collections, while streetwear brands have been collaborating with high fashion designers to create unique pieces.

Cultural Significance

Both streetwear and high fashion have significant cultural significance. Streetwear has emerged from urban cultures such as skate, hip-hop, and graffiti, while high fashion is often associated with European aristocracy and royalty. Both styles represent different aspects of culture and have helped shape the fashion industry’s direction over the years.

Popularity

Finally, both streetwear and high fashion are incredibly popular, with millions of people around the world following the latest trends and styles. High fashion is often featured on the runway and in high-end fashion magazines, while streetwear is often seen on social media and worn by celebrities and influencers. Both styles have massive followings and are likely to continue being popular in the coming years.
